.cell.svelte-b5lvvc{width:100%;height:100%;background:transparent;font-size:.7rem;display:grid;place-content:center;overflow:hidden;box-sizing:border-box;cursor:pointer}.showBorder.svelte-b5lvvc{border:1px solid var(--border-color)}.active.svelte-b5lvvc{background:var(--theme-color)}.cell.svelte-b5lvvc:hover{border:2px solid var(--border-color)}.active.svelte-b5lvvc:hover{border:2px solid white}.cell.active.svelte-b5lvvc{color:#fff}.container.svelte-n2fku9{height:100%}.grid.svelte-n2fku9{display:grid;grid-gap:0px;margin:0 auto;height:100%}.loading.svelte-1hvhtef{place-content:center;height:100%;display:grid}button.svelte-s6kkhe{background:var(--theme-color);color:#fff;border:0;height:24px;width:100%;font-family:monospace;cursor:pointer;margin-top:.5rem}button.svelte-s6kkhe:hover{background:#333}button.svelte-s6kkhe:disabled{background:#ccc;color:#666;cursor:not-allowed}.number-range-selector.svelte-fiwb82 button.svelte-fiwb82{background:var(--theme-color);color:#fff;border:0;height:24px;width:48px;cursor:pointer}.number-range-selector.disabled.svelte-fiwb82 button.svelte-fiwb82{background:#ccc;color:#666;cursor:not-allowed}.number-range-selector.svelte-fiwb82 button.svelte-fiwb82:hover{background:#333}.number-range-selector.disabled.svelte-fiwb82 button.svelte-fiwb82:hover{background:#aaa;cursor:not-allowed}.flex.svelte-fiwb82.svelte-fiwb82{display:flex;flex-direction:row;align-items:center}.number-range-selector.svelte-fiwb82 p.svelte-fiwb82{display:grid;border:1px solid var(--theme-color);box-sizing:border-box;height:24px;flex:1;text-align:center;align-content:center;margin:0}.number-range-selector.disabled.svelte-fiwb82 p.svelte-fiwb82{border:1px solid #ccc;color:#ccc}.stat-container.svelte-18tgzr5.svelte-18tgzr5{display:flex;flex-direction:row;padding:8px;box-sizing:border-box}.stat-container.svelte-18tgzr5 span.svelte-18tgzr5{color:var(--theme-color)}.stat-title.svelte-18tgzr5.svelte-18tgzr5{flex:1}h1.svelte-1aqbadq{border-bottom:1px solid var(--border-color);margin:0;padding:1rem 8px;box-sizing:border-box}.switch.svelte-6gtm7m.svelte-6gtm7m{display:block;width:100%;display:flex;height:24px}.switch.svelte-6gtm7m .svelte-6gtm7m{box-sizing:border-box}.btn.svelte-6gtm7m.svelte-6gtm7m{border:1px solid #1a1a1a;display:grid;align-items:center;height:100%;position:relative;text-align:center;transition:background .6s ease,color .6s ease;flex:1}input[type=radio].toggle.svelte-6gtm7m.svelte-6gtm7m{display:none}input[type=radio].toggle.svelte-6gtm7m+label.svelte-6gtm7m{cursor:pointer;min-width:60px}input[type=radio].toggle.svelte-6gtm7m+label.svelte-6gtm7m:hover{background:none;color:#1a1a1a}input[type=radio].toggle.svelte-6gtm7m+label.svelte-6gtm7m:after{background:#1a1a1a;content:"";height:100%;position:absolute;top:0;transition:left .2s cubic-bezier(.77,0,.175,1);width:100%;z-index:-1}input[type=radio].toggle.toggle-left.svelte-6gtm7m+label.svelte-6gtm7m{border-right:0}input[type=radio].toggle.toggle-left.svelte-6gtm7m+label.svelte-6gtm7m:after{left:100%}input[type=radio].toggle.toggle-right.svelte-6gtm7m+label.svelte-6gtm7m:after{left:-100%}input[type=radio].toggle.svelte-6gtm7m:checked+label.svelte-6gtm7m{cursor:default;color:#fff;transition:color .2s}input[type=radio].toggle.svelte-6gtm7m:checked+label.svelte-6gtm7m:after{left:0}.picker.svelte-uiwgvv{position:relative;width:100%;height:100%;background:linear-gradient(#ffffff00,#000000ff),linear-gradient(.25turn,#ffffffff,#00000000),var(--color-bg);outline:none;-webkit-user-select:none;user-select:none}.slider.svelte-14nweqy{--gradient:#ff0000, #ffff00 17.2%, #ffff00 18.2%, #00ff00 33.3%, #00ffff 49.5%, #00ffff 51.5%, #0000ff 67.7%, #ff00ff 83.3%, #ff0000;position:relative;width:100%;height:100%;background:linear-gradient(var(--gradient));outline:none;-webkit-user-select:none;user-select:none}.to-right.svelte-14nweqy{background:linear-gradient(.25turn,var(--gradient))}.alpha.svelte-f2vq53:after{position:absolute;content:"";top:0;right:0;bottom:0;left:0;background:linear-gradient(#00000000,var(--alpha-color));z-index:0}.to-right.svelte-f2vq53:after{background:linear-gradient(.25turn,#00000000,var(--alpha-color))}.alpha.svelte-f2vq53{position:relative;width:100%;height:100%;background-image:linear-gradient(45deg,#eee 25%,transparent 25%,transparent 75%,#eee 75%),linear-gradient(45deg,#eee 25%,transparent 25%,transparent 75%,#eee 75%);background-size:var(--pattern-size-2x, 12px) var(--pattern-size-2x, 12px);background-position:0 0,var(--pattern-size, 6px) var(--pattern-size, 6px);outline:none;-webkit-user-select:none;user-select:none}.text-input.svelte-11z4jba{display:flex;flex-direction:column;gap:10px;margin:10px 5px 5px}.input-container.svelte-11z4jba{display:flex;flex:1;gap:10px}input.svelte-11z4jba,button.svelte-11z4jba{flex:1;border:none;background-color:#eee;padding:0;border-radius:5px;height:30px;line-height:30px;text-align:center}input.svelte-11z4jba{width:5px}button.svelte-11z4jba{cursor:pointer;flex:1;margin:0;transition:background-color .2s}button.svelte-11z4jba:hover{background-color:#ccc}input.svelte-11z4jba:focus,button.svelte-11z4jba:focus{outline:none}input.svelte-11z4jba:focus-visible,button.svelte-11z4jba:focus-visible{outline:2px solid var(--focus-color, red);outline-offset:2px}div.svelte-13znx8u{position:absolute;width:9.5px;height:9.5px;background-color:#fff;border-radius:5px;margin-left:1.5px;pointer-events:none;z-index:1;border:1px solid black;box-sizing:border-box}div.svelte-1hhmcjg{display:inline-block;margin-right:5px;width:var(--picker-width, 200px);height:var(--picker-height, 200px);border-radius:8px;overflow:hidden;outline:2px solid transparent;outline-offset:3px;transition:outline .2s ease-in-out;-webkit-user-select:none;user-select:none}div.focused.svelte-1hhmcjg{outline:2px solid var(--focus-color, red)}div.svelte-1udewng{display:inline-block;margin-right:5px;width:var(--slider-width, 12px);height:var(--picker-height, 200px);border-radius:6px;overflow:hidden;-webkit-user-select:none;user-select:none;outline:2px solid transparent;outline-offset:3px;transition:outline .2s ease-in-out}div.focused.svelte-1udewng{outline:2px solid var(--focus-color, red)}label.svelte-2ybi8r{display:flex;align-items:center;gap:8px;cursor:pointer;border-radius:3px;margin:4px}.container.svelte-2ybi8r{position:relative;display:block;display:flex;align-items:center;justify-content:center}input.svelte-2ybi8r{padding:0;border:none;width:4px;height:4px;flex-shrink:0;cursor:pointer;border-radius:50%;margin:0 12px}.alpha.svelte-2ybi8r{clip-path:circle(50%);background-image:linear-gradient(to right,rgba(238,238,238,.75),rgba(238,238,238,.75)),linear-gradient(to right,black 50%,white 50%),linear-gradient(to bottom,black 50%,white 50%);background-blend-mode:normal,difference,normal;background-size:12px 12px}.alpha.svelte-2ybi8r,.color.svelte-2ybi8r{position:absolute;width:30px;height:30px;border-radius:15px;-webkit-user-select:none;user-select:none}input.svelte-2ybi8r:focus{outline:2px solid var(--focus-color, red);outline-offset:15px}div.svelte-6lhts{padding:8px 5px 5px 8px;background-color:#fff;margin:0 10px 10px;border:1px solid black;border-radius:12px;display:none;width:max-content}.isOpen.svelte-6lhts{display:block}.isPopup.svelte-6lhts{position:absolute;top:30px;z-index:var(--picker-z-index, 2)}details.svelte-1s4dluu.svelte-1s4dluu{width:245px;margin:8px auto}summary.svelte-1s4dluu.svelte-1s4dluu{margin-bottom:8px;cursor:pointer;transition:color .2s}summary.svelte-1s4dluu.svelte-1s4dluu:hover{color:#00f}.not-closable.svelte-1s4dluu summary.svelte-1s4dluu{pointer-events:none}.not-closable.svelte-1s4dluu summary.svelte-1s4dluu{list-style:none}.svelte-1s4dluu.svelte-1s4dluu:focus-visible,span.svelte-1s4dluu :focus-visible{border-radius:2px;outline:2px solid var(--focus-color, red);outline-offset:2px}.a11y-single-notice.svelte-obnxge.svelte-obnxge{display:flex;align-items:center;margin:4px 0;gap:12px;height:48px}.large.svelte-obnxge.svelte-obnxge{font-size:22px}.score.svelte-obnxge.svelte-obnxge{width:95px;flex-shrink:0;margin-bottom:10px}.score.svelte-obnxge p.svelte-obnxge{margin-bottom:2px}.grade.svelte-obnxge.svelte-obnxge{border-radius:50px;padding:2px 8px;background-color:orange;font-weight:700}.grade-ok.svelte-obnxge.svelte-obnxge{background-color:green;color:#fff}p.svelte-obnxge.svelte-obnxge{margin:0}.lorem.svelte-obnxge.svelte-obnxge{flex:1;text-align:center;padding:4px 8px;border-radius:4px;border:1px solid black;white-space:nowrap;text-overflow:ellipsis;overflow:hidden}span.svelte-7ntk55{position:relative}div.svelte-1nw247x{position:absolute;width:10px;height:10px;background-color:#fff;border-radius:5px;pointer-events:none;z-index:1;transition:box-shadow .2s}div.svelte-607izz{display:inline-block;margin-bottom:5px;width:var(--picker-width, 260px);height:var(--picker-height, 200px);border-radius:8px 8px 0 0;overflow:hidden;outline:2px solid transparent;outline-offset:3px;transition:outline .2s ease-in-out;-webkit-user-select:none;user-select:none}div.focused.svelte-607izz{outline:2px solid var(--focus-color, red)}div.svelte-hspaza{position:absolute;width:6px;height:6px;background-color:#fff;border-radius:5px;margin-top:2px;pointer-events:none;z-index:1;border:1px solid black;box-sizing:border-box}div.svelte-1apx9th{display:inline-block;margin:4px;width:calc(var(--picker-width, 260px) - 10px);height:var(--slider-width, 10px);border-radius:7px;overflow:hidden;outline:2px solid transparent;outline-offset:3px;transition:outline .2s ease-in-out;-webkit-user-select:none;user-select:none;--pattern-size:5px;--pattern-size-2x:10px}div.focused.svelte-1apx9th{outline:2px solid var(--focus-color, red)}div.svelte-13oqf85{background-color:#fff;margin:0 10px 15px;padding-bottom:3px;border:1px solid black;border-radius:8px;display:none}.isOpen.svelte-13oqf85{display:flex;flex-direction:column}.isPopup.svelte-13oqf85{position:absolute;top:15px;z-index:var(--picker-z-index, 2)}div.svelte-13oqf85:not(.isPopup){display:inline-flex;flex-direction:column}div.svelte-13oqf85 .text-input{margin:5px}div.svelte-15af9gx{padding:8px 5px 5px 8px;background-color:#fff;margin:0 10px 10px;border:1px solid black;border-radius:12px;display:none}.isOpen.svelte-15af9gx{display:block}@media (min-width: 768px){.isOpen.svelte-15af9gx{display:grid;gap:5px;grid-template:"picker . . a11y" "input input input a11y"}}div.svelte-15af9gx .picker{grid-area:picker}div.svelte-15af9gx .text-input{grid-area:input}div.svelte-15af9gx .a11y-notice{grid-area:a11y;margin:0 4px 0 6px}.isPopup.svelte-15af9gx{position:absolute;top:15px;z-index:var(--picker-z-index, 2)}#play-pause-controls.svelte-18z4p9c.svelte-18z4p9c{display:flex;flex-direction:row;gap:8px}#play-pause-controls.svelte-18z4p9c .svelte-18z4p9c{flex:1}.svg-container.svelte-18z4p9c.svelte-18z4p9c{display:inline-flex;align-items:center;height:100%}.controls-container.svelte-18z4p9c.svelte-18z4p9c{height:100%;width:100%;margin:0;display:flex;flex-direction:column}.controls-container.svelte-18z4p9c h1.svelte-18z4p9c{border-bottom:1px solid var(--border-color);border-top:1px solid var(--border-color);margin:0;padding:1rem 8px;box-sizing:border-box}.controls-container.svelte-18z4p9c h1.svelte-18z4p9c{border-top:0}.controls-padding.svelte-18z4p9c.svelte-18z4p9c{padding:1rem 8px;box-sizing:border-box}.ctrl.svelte-18z4p9c.svelte-18z4p9c{flex:1;border-bottom:1px solid var(--border-color)}aside.svelte-1kneqh3{width:200px;height:100%;border-right:1px solid var(--border-color)}.game-container.svelte-1kneqh3{flex:1;height:100%;display:grid;place-content:center;margin:0 10px;min-width:0}
